| Index: components/metrics/test_metrics_service_client.cc
|
| diff --git a/components/metrics/test_metrics_service_client.cc b/components/metrics/test_metrics_service_client.cc
|
| index e5e97780ec0fad9d4688c0198397ff70908363b1..c60db0b151bbc75be86c5564e0ed68453454e9bb 100644
|
| --- a/components/metrics/test_metrics_service_client.cc
|
| +++ b/components/metrics/test_metrics_service_client.cc
|
| @@ -6,6 +6,7 @@
|
|
|
| #include "base/callback.h"
|
| #include "components/metrics/metrics_log_uploader.h"
|
| +#include "components/metrics/proto/chrome_user_metrics_extension.pb.h"
|
|
|
| namespace metrics {
|
|
|
| @@ -13,7 +14,8 @@ namespace metrics {
|
| const char TestMetricsServiceClient::kBrandForTesting[] = "brand_for_testing";
|
|
|
| TestMetricsServiceClient::TestMetricsServiceClient()
|
| - : version_string_("5.0.322.0-64-devel") {
|
| + : version_string_("5.0.322.0-64-devel"),
|
| + product_(ChromeUserMetricsExtension::CHROME) {
|
| }
|
|
|
| TestMetricsServiceClient::~TestMetricsServiceClient() {
|
| @@ -28,6 +30,10 @@ bool TestMetricsServiceClient::IsOffTheRecordSessionActive() {
|
| return false;
|
| }
|
|
|
| +int32_t TestMetricsServiceClient::GetProduct() {
|
| + return product_;
|
| +}
|
| +
|
| std::string TestMetricsServiceClient::GetApplicationLocale() {
|
| return "en-US";
|
| }
|
|
|